Bomber shared by Travlr at the 21st Richmond Gathering, 11/1/14. Pours a copper color with a thin head. Fair head retention. Aroma of toffee, stone fruit, citrus. The taste is citrus hops, caramel malt. Decent balance, solid.

Bottle. Pours a cloudy murky orange brown with a tan head that dissipates to the edges. Aroma has notes of grain and bourbon with a bit of apple and some underlying Belgian yeast. Flavor begins with grains and bread and grows to have a bit of apple, citrus, bourbon and Belgian yeast.
